I wrote an article about Van McCoy for Dave Moore's "There's That Beat" - the more I dug into the man the more I was in awe of him. The real highlight was tracking down and befriending David Kapralik his long time partner at Columbia/Date, freckling awesome dude !!:wub::huh:

Van McCoy has been forever synonymous with soul music and not many soul stars can match his contribution. Chris Lalor takes a look at the man, his life, his music and pays tribute to one of the few people who wear the mantle of "legendary" in complete comfort.
